Electronic Shooting EarMuffs Buying Guide + FAQ

How to Choose the Best Hearing Protection for Shooting or Operating Loud Equipment

If you shoot guns, you know you need hearing protection. We all know someone who has damaged their hearing beyond repair through shooting guns or working around heavy machinery without wearing proper protection. 

Hearing protection has come a long way and you have plenty of choices on the market. It’s important that you understand each option so you can make an educated decision when it comes to choosing the best hearing protection for shooting. 

Your hearing can easily be damaged by repetitive loud noises or one extremely loud noise. You have to be sure to adequately protect your hearing every time or you could lose hearing over the years. 

There are basically 3 main types of hearing protection to choose from: 

  1. Passive earmuffs: These simply fit over your ears and form a protective barrier that will shield your ears from loud noises. You can find these in any sporting goods store and they usually don’t cost too much. Passive earmuffs have improved over the years and many offer a high NRR that can provide a level of protection. Keep in mind, it may be nearly impossible to hold a conversation while wearing passive earmuffs. 
  2. Basic earplugs: Foam earplugs are extremely cheap and you can buy a handful at a time. They actually give you decent protection if you’re in a bind and need one immediately. In fact, many of them have a NRR or noise reduction rating of 33dB which will protect you as long as they are inserted correctly. 
  3. Electronic earmuffs: These are the best in our opinion. They give you plenty of protection from loud noises and you can still hold a conversation. You can hear everything around you and aren’t muffled like you are with the other options. It’s easy to talk to the person next to you and are considered safer to use at gun ranges because you can easily hear commands. Electronic earmuffs work by suppressing sound that reaches a certain level. You can stay alert to all noises around you and they will protect your ears the moment a loud noise is detected. 

Now that you see the different types of hearing protection for shooting guns, you also need to know how to choose the best brand or model:

Price: While you can’t put a price on your long-term hearing, it’s understandable that price is always a consideration when choosing shooting range gear. Foam earplugs will be the cheapest, followed by passive earmuffs with electronic earmuffs being the most expensive. 

Fit: If your hearing protection doesn’t fit, it won’t work effectively. Foam earplugs are self-explanatory, but you still need to ensure you have a good seal for them to do their job correctly. You can’t just stuff them in and expect them to work. You must roll them between your fingers and insert them into your ear canal. They will expand and create a seal. 

Earmuffs feature adjustable earcups and headbands with extra padding to help get a better fit. Children and women may have a harder time choosing a perfect fit, but they make earmuffs designed to fit smaller heads. 

NRR or Noise Reduction Rating: Hearing protection for the gun range will have a number NRR number assigned to it that signifies how it ranks. You will want to find hearing protection with a high NRR rating to give you the best hearing protection while shooting or operating loud equipment.

How Are Electronic Shooting Ear Muffs Rated? 

Electronic shooting ear muffs use the NRR rating or Noise Reduction Rating system. A high NRR rating means the electronic ear muffs have a higher efficiency noise reduction rating. Most electronic earmuffs fall within the NRR 22 range and will adequately protect your ears from loud sounds such as gunshots, lawnmowers, tractors and more. 

Is a Higher dB Rating Better for Earmuffs?

An electronic earmuff’s hearing protection effectiveness is rated using the NRR or Noise Reduction Rating. Electronic earmuffs with higher NRR numbers usually have a higher capacity to reduce noise. We recommend purchasing electronic earmuffs that have a high NRR.

Are Ear Plugs or Ear Muffs Better for Shooting? 

You’ve likely searched for the best ear protection for shooting and have come across countless articles about ear plugs versus ear muffs for shooting. Both types of hearing protection have their advantages and disadvantages, but we can all agree that using either one is better than nothing.  

Ear muffs have their advantages when it comes to comfort and convenience. They easily fit over the entirety of your ears which many professionals believe provides more protection for your hearing. You’ve probably noticed that ear plugs usually have higher NRR ratings than electronic earmuffs which can be confusing since earmuffs cover your ears. While ear plugs may have a higher NRR rating in most cases, they tend to leave gaps that could let in noise and thus lower their ability to adequately protect you.  

However, ear plugs can be found cheaper and are easy to carry. You can simply stick them in your pocket and go. They are absolutely better than having nothing on hand, but it is recommended that you eventually get a high-quality pair of electronic ear muffs to ensure you’re protected.  

Can You Wear Ear Muffs and Ear Plugs at the Same Time? 

Many shooters wear both ear plugs and electronic ear muffs at the same time. While you may not need to do this, there is nothing wrong with doubling up on both types of hearing protection. This could be beneficial if you shoot for hours at a time.
